Output 1087524b21c7ae7c68d99e04f9303f40639d427446d5e3b0109924950dfabc05:1

value
6452037
script pubkey
OP_0 OP_PUSHBYTES_20 e52d690837adc2dbac4b1b8482e1ca1f6c54a6cc
address
ltc1qu5kkjzph4hpdhtztrwzg9cw2rak9ffkvvrpqhk
transaction
1087524b21c7ae7c68d99e04f9303f40639d427446d5e3b0109924950dfabc05
spent
true